Pond Lighting Installation in Overland Park, KS
Pond lighting installation enhances the visual appeal and safety of outdoor water features, creating a warm and inviting ambiance during evening hours. This service typically covers a variety of projects, including illuminating pond edges, highlighting waterfalls, or accenting decorative aquatic plants. Homeowners often seek guidance on suitable lighting options, placement strategies, and energy-efficient solutions to ensure their pond remains safe, functional, and aesthetically pleasing after dark.
Before requesting pond lighting installation, property owners should consider the size and layout of their pond, existing electrical infrastructure, and desired lighting effects. It’s helpful to understand any local regulations or restrictions related to outdoor lighting and electrical work. Clear communication about the intended atmosphere, specific features to highlight, and budget considerations can also support a smooth installation process.

Common Pond Lighting Installation Jobs
Pond lighting installation enhances the visibility and safety of backyard water features.
Underwater lighting creates a captivating focal point and highlights pond details.
LED pond lights provide energy-efficient illumination with long-lasting performance.
Floating lights add a decorative touch and improve overall pond ambiance.
Submersible lighting ensures reliable operation in wet environments and underwater settings.
Landscape lighting integration can complement pond features for a cohesive outdoor look.
Pond Lighting Installation Questions
What types of pond lighting are available? There are various options including underwater lights, spotlights, and accent fixtures to enhance pond features and create ambiance.
Is pond lighting safe for aquatic life? Yes, properly installed pond lighting is designed to be safe for fish and plants, with waterproof and low-voltage options available.
Can pond lighting be installed in existing ponds? Yes, lighting can typically be added to existing ponds, with adjustments made to suit the pond’s layout and features.
What should property owners consider before installing pond lighting? Consider the pond’s size, desired effect, and accessibility for maintenance when planning the lighting setup.
